Citation Practice


"Average U.S. temperatures have already risen by 2°F over the past 50 years, and are projected  to rise another 7–11°F by the end of this century under a high-emissions scenario, and 4–6.5°F under a low-emissions scenario" (Ackerman, Stanton 1).
